
The Governor of the Mexican State of Jalisco, Aristóteles Sandoval, has extended an invitation to Consuls General, Honorary Consuls and other guests including NGIN President Fred Walti in Los Angeles to visit his state and the city of Guadalajara from March 15th to March 18th, 2018.
The state of Jalisco is the cradle of many of the Mexican traditions that are known worldwide, such as mariachi and tequila. Jalisco is also one of the states in Mexico that has a very important economy, and is the most relevant center of technological development and innovation in Latin America. The state capital, Guadalajara, is known as the Mexican “Silicon Valley”, and is home to prominent companies like IBM, Motorola, Oracle, HP, Intel and Flextronics, to name just some.
The trip will include a cultural and historical visit to the town of Tequila, where the Mexican national drink is original from, located 60 kilometers from Guadalajara.
